Contact Us

The 5 Most Successful Cricket Team Captains in Indian History

From Kapil Dev to Mahendra Singh Dhoni, India has produced exceptional cricket captains over the years. Here we take a look at the 5 most successful cricket team captains in Indian history.

Ankit Kanaujia
Last updated: 25.05.2022
Most Successful Cricket Team Captains in Indian History

Cricket is easily the most popular and loved sport in the country and it has had decades worth of a cult following. Within this history, there have been countless impressive performances from Indian cricket players, and out of these, Indian cricket captains over the decades have left the deepest impressions on Indian cricket history.


From Kapil Dev to Mahendra Singh Dhoni, India has produced exceptional cricket captains over the years, whose performances have brought immense glory to the country and made us one of the most prolific cricket teams in the world.


Therefore, in this article, we have decided to recognize and talk about the careers of the five greatest Indian cricket team captains in history. Of course, there were many more cricketers that we couldn’t include in this list but that doesn’t make them any less impressive!


Note: This list is not ranked!


1. Rahul Dravid

Career: 1996 - 2012

Rahul Dravid is known for his outstanding batting technique and is also known for being one of the most dependable cricket players in Indian history, which also earned him the nickname, “The Wall”.


Rahul Dravid also gained widespread recognition for his steady captaincy, under which he led the Indian team to a few memorable victories, especially in test series.


2. Mohammad Azharuddin

Career: 1984 - 2000

While many people remember Mohammad Azharuddin for his controversial ban from cricket due to a match-fixing scandal, he was in fact, one of the most successful Indian cricket captains. With 90 ODIs wins and 14 test series wins, Azharuddin led the Indian cricket team through many impressive performances. In fact, his 14 test wins were a record until he was beaten by Sourav Ganguly, who had 21 test wins in his career as the cricket captain.


3. Kapil Dev

Career: 1978 - 1994

Kapil Dev is an undeniable legend in the books of Indian cricket history. He was the first cricket captain to lead the Indian team to victory in the historic 1983 Cricket World Cup. Kapil Dev is also known as one of the best all-rounder players in the world.

Kapil Dev was also named the Indian Cricketer of the Century in 2002 by Wisden. Kapil Dev has also been appreciated by fellow cricketer and former cricket captain, Sunil Gavaskar, who remarked that Dev is one of the best all-rounders in Indian cricket.


4. Sourav Ganguly

Career: 1992 - 2008

Who can forget our beloved Dada, who was perhaps one of the most amazing players to have ever captained the Indian cricket team? Sourav Ganguly had an impressive track record of wins under his leadership - with 21 test victories and 76 ODI wins.

Ganguly was a left-handed batsman who was especially good at his off-side play, which earned him another nickname, “The God of the Offside”.


5. Mahendra Singh Dhoni

Career: 2004 - 2019

Mahendra Singh Dhoni has earned a well-deserved reputation as one of the best cricketers as well as captains in the country. Also known lovingly as “Mahi”, Dhoni led the Indian cricket team to win three ICC trophies. He has also been the long-term captain of the Chennai Super Kings in the IPL.

Even now, Dhoni remains a favorite during the IPL, with most Indian betting sites supporting his performance with extremely high odds.

Chase Your Sport

Stay up-to-date on the latest sports news, stats, expert analysis and trends, including cricket, football, wrestling, tennis, basketball, Formula One and more. Find previews, schedules, results of upcoming events, and fantasy tips on Chase Your Sport.